cmake-202x (cross-platform, open-source make system)
CMake is used to control the software process using simple platform
and compiler independent configuration files. CMake generates
native makefiles and workspaces that can be used in the
compiler environment of your choice.
This version of cmake is much newer than the version included in
Slackware 14.2. It installs to /opt, so it won't conflict with the
OS-provided cmake package.
See README_SBo.txt for directions on using this version of cmake with
your own SlackBuild scripts, or to develop/maintain software that
needs a newer cmake.
